Carbon Footprint for Norwegian SMEs: A Complete 2026 Guide
Why Norwegian Businesses Are Receiving Carbon Questionnaires
Carbon footprint reporting for Norwegian small businesses is an emerging requirement in 2026 despite Norway having Europe's cleanest electricity grid. Two factors are driving supply chain carbon requests:
1. EU supply chain reach — Norway is an EEA member and closely integrated with EU markets. Norwegian companies supplying EU businesses subject to CSRD are receiving carbon data requests regardless of Norwegian domestic regulation. Norway's own large companies (Equinor, Telenor, DNB, Yara) have CSRD-equivalent reporting obligations and are collecting supplier data.
2. Norwegian Climate Act — Norway has a legally binding 55% emission reduction target by 2030 and net zero by 2050, creating sectoral pressure that flows into supply chain requirements in oil and gas services, shipping, and seafood export.
Norwegian Emission Factors
Norway's electricity grid is approximately 88–92% hydropower — giving it one of the world's lowest electricity emission factors:
| Source | Factor | Unit |
|---|---|---|
| Norwegian grid electricity | 0.011 | kgCO2e per kWh |
| Natural gas | 0.204 | kgCO2e per kWh |
| Diesel (road) | 2.683 | kgCO2e per litre |
| Petrol | 2.267 | kgCO2e per litre |
| LPG | 1.555 | kgCO2e per litre |
| Norwegian average car | 0.095 | kgCO2e per km (high EV fleet) |
Key implication: For Norwegian office businesses, Scope 2 electricity emissions are negligible (0.011 factor). The dominant emission sources are Scope 1 gas heating, Scope 3 business travel (long domestic distances), and commuting. Norway also has one of the highest EV adoption rates in the world (over 80% of new car sales in 2024), so fleet emissions are declining rapidly.
Norway's Unique Carbon Reporting Context
Norwegian businesses in the oil and gas services sector face particularly detailed carbon reporting requirements. Equinor, Aker BP, and TotalEnergies Norge require their contractors and suppliers to provide:
- Scope 1 and 2 emissions with offshore/onshore split
- Energy efficiency indicators (kWh per manhour or per tonne processed)
- GHG reduction targets aligned with Norwegian Continental Shelf (NCS) electrification goals
For non-oil businesses, standard CSRD-aligned Scope 1, 2, and 3 reporting applies.
Worked Example: Norwegian SME Carbon Calculation
Sample company: A 12-person Bergen-based engineering consultancy
Scope 1 — Gas heating: 3,200 m³ × 2.04 kgCO2e/m³ = 6,528 kgCO2e = 6.5 tCO2e
Scope 2 — Norwegian electricity: 28,000 kWh × 0.011 = 308 kgCO2e = 0.3 tCO2e
Scope 3 — Business travel (Bergen–Oslo flights × 20 return trips): 3.1 tCO2e
Scope 3 — Commuting (12 staff, Bergen): 3.4 tCO2e
Scope 3 — Waste: 0.3 tCO2e
Total: 13.6 tCO2e | Per employee: 1.1 tCO2e/FTE

Frequently Asked Questions
Why is Norway's electricity emission factor so low?
Norway's electricity grid is approximately 88–92% hydropower, with the remainder primarily wind and a small amount of gas. This gives Norway one of the world's lowest grid emission factors at approximately 0.011 kgCO2e per kWh — over 35 times cleaner than the UK (0.207) and nearly 60 times cleaner than Germany (0.380 in 2023). For Norwegian office businesses, Scope 1 gas heating completely dominates over Scope 2 electricity.
Do Norwegian businesses need to comply with CSRD?
Norway is not an EU member state but is an EEA member and closely integrated with EU markets. Norway has implemented equivalent sustainability reporting requirements for large Norwegian companies through the Norwegian Accounting Act amendments. Norwegian companies supplying EU businesses subject to CSRD are also receiving carbon data requests through supply chain obligations regardless of domestic regulation.
What are the main carbon emission sources for a Norwegian office business?
For a typical Norwegian office business: Scope 1 gas heating is the dominant source (Norwegian buildings rely heavily on gas and district heating); Scope 2 electricity is negligible (0.011 factor); Scope 3 business travel is significant due to long domestic distances (Oslo–Bergen, Oslo–Tromsø flights); and commuting. Fleet emissions are declining rapidly as Norway has over 80% EV penetration in new car sales.
How does Norway's EV market affect carbon reporting?
Norway's exceptionally high EV adoption rate (over 80% of new car registrations in 2024) means company fleets are rapidly electrifying. Electric vehicles charged on Norway's near-zero hydro grid generate approximately 0.011 × kWh consumed in tCO2e — a tiny fraction of equivalent diesel vehicles. Norwegian businesses transitioning to EV fleets see dramatic Scope 1 reductions and should document this transition in their Carbon Passport year-on-year.
What Norwegian companies are requesting supplier carbon data?
Large Norwegian companies with active supplier carbon data programmes include: Equinor (oil and gas services supply chain, with specific offshore/onshore emissions requirements), Telenor (telecommunications supplier ESG questionnaires), DNB (banking supply chain sustainability), Yara (fertiliser and agricultural supply chain), and Tomra (recycling technology suppliers). Norwegian shipping companies including Odfjell, Stolt-Nielsen, and BW Group also have supplier carbon programmes.
